All undergraduate applicants are eligible for academic scholarship with a GPA of 3.0 or above. For full financial aid consideration, you must file the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) form, preferably by April 15 of your senior year, and include Valpo’s school code: 001842. See valpo.edu/scholarships for details.
• TUITION AND FEES: $48,450
• ON-CAMPUS ROOM/MEALS: $13,618
• TOTAL DIRECT CHARGES: $62,068
Students earning below a 3.0 GPA may also be eligible for gift aid from Valparaiso University upon admission. Add Valpo's school code (008142) to your FAFSA form to maximize your scholarship consideration!
Scholarships for transfer students range from $22,000 - $25,000 depending on transferable GPA. Additional transfer scholarships for Phi Theta Kappa, associate’s degree completion, and other partnerships range from $1,000 - $4,000.

• File our online application at valpo.edu/apply.
• Apply via CommonApp at commonapp.org/explore/valparaiso-university.
• Have your school counselor or registrar’s office send your official high school or college transcripts to our admission office.
• Valpo is test optional and does not require you to submit SAT or ACT scores; however, if you would like your scores to be considered, please indicate this on your application and send your scores to Valpo.
• Have you taken Advanced Placement, International Baccalaureate, or other college-level tests? Send us those scores, too.
• NO application fee or essay required!
DEADLINE:
• Students who apply by May 1 are promised full consideration for admission, academic scholarships, and financial aid.
